COUNCIL OF MASSACHUSETTS TO JOHN HANCOCK.

[Read November 20, 1775.]

Council Chamber, November 11, 1775.

GENTLEMEN: Captain Robbins, from Ireland, bound to Boston, was taken, on Tuesday last, by one of our boats, and carried into Beverly. This vessel is loaded with provisions. He brought a number of letters for the officers in the Army and others. We sent them to General Washington

v3:1532

for his perusal; and we now despatch a messenger (Revere) with them to the honourable Congress.

In the name and by order of the Council:

JAMES OTIS, President.

Hon˙ John Hancock, Esq.
